ترتيب الآية | رقم السورة | رقم الآية | الاية |
2197 | 18 | 57 | ومن أظلم ممن ذكر بآيات ربه فأعرض عنها ونسي ما قدمت يداه إنا جعلنا على قلوبهم أكنة أن يفقهوه وفي آذانهم وقرا وإن تدعهم إلى الهدى فلن يهتدوا إذا أبدا |
| | | And who is more unjust than one who is reminded of the verses of his Lord but turns away from them and forgets what his hands have put forth? Indeed, We have placed over their hearts coverings, lest they understand it, and in their ears deafness. And if you invite them to guidance - they will never be guided, then - ever. |
|
2198 | 18 | 58 | وربك الغفور ذو الرحمة لو يؤاخذهم بما كسبوا لعجل لهم العذاب بل لهم موعد لن يجدوا من دونه موئلا |
| | | And your Lord is the Forgiving, full of mercy. If He were to impose blame upon them for what they earned, He would have hastened for them the punishment. Rather, for them is an appointment from which they will never find an escape. |
|
2199 | 18 | 59 | وتلك القرى أهلكناهم لما ظلموا وجعلنا لمهلكهم موعدا |
| | | And those cities - We destroyed them when they wronged, and We made for their destruction an appointed time. |
|
2200 | 18 | 60 | وإذ قال موسى لفتاه لا أبرح حتى أبلغ مجمع البحرين أو أمضي حقبا |
| | | And [mention] when Moses said to his servant, "I will not cease [traveling] until I reach the junction of the two seas or continue for a long period." |
|
2201 | 18 | 61 | فلما بلغا مجمع بينهما نسيا حوتهما فاتخذ سبيله في البحر سربا |
| | | But when they reached the junction between them, they forgot their fish, and it took its course into the sea, slipping away. |
|
2202 | 18 | 62 | فلما جاوزا قال لفتاه آتنا غداءنا لقد لقينا من سفرنا هذا نصبا |
| | | So when they had passed beyond it, [Moses] said to his boy, "Bring us our morning meal. We have certainly suffered in this, our journey, [much] fatigue." |
|
2203 | 18 | 63 | قال أرأيت إذ أوينا إلى الصخرة فإني نسيت الحوت وما أنسانيه إلا الشيطان أن أذكره واتخذ سبيله في البحر عجبا |
| | | He said, "Did you see when we retired to the rock? Indeed, I forgot [there] the fish. And none made me forget it except Satan - that I should mention it. And it took its course into the sea amazingly". |
|
2204 | 18 | 64 | قال ذلك ما كنا نبغ فارتدا على آثارهما قصصا |
| | | [Moses] said, "That is what we were seeking." So they returned, following their footprints. |
|
2205 | 18 | 65 | فوجدا عبدا من عبادنا آتيناه رحمة من عندنا وعلمناه من لدنا علما |
| | | And they found a servant from among Our servants to whom we had given mercy from us and had taught him from Us a [certain] knowledge. |
|
2206 | 18 | 66 | قال له موسى هل أتبعك على أن تعلمن مما علمت رشدا |
| | | Moses said to him, "May I follow you on [the condition] that you teach me from what you have been taught of sound judgement?" |
